THE PEOPLE OF THE STATE OF NEW YORK, Respondent, v. JAMEL PARKER, Appellant.

Appellate Division of the Supreme Court of New York, First Department.

February 14, 2013.


Judgment, Supreme Court, Bronx County (Judith Lieb, J.), rendered January 6, 2011, convicting defendant, after a jury trial, of robbery in the second degree and criminal possession of a weapon in the fourth degree, and sentencing him to an aggregate term of 3½ years, unanimously affirmed.
